Haulio starts as a Kenya-first marketplace for professional truck capacity. The long-term idea is broader: match something that needs to move with suitable transport capacity—but every new transport mode has to earn its way through demand, safety, operations and regulation.
Status: Truck freight is the live focus. Parcel delivery and shared intercity travel are visible future concepts with no live booking action. Haulio is a connector marketplace, not a carrier, insurer or passenger transport operator.

The platform is useful only when its records are current and the truck is actually suitable for the cargo. Public browsing helps people understand available capacity; a real shipment request is still required before Haulio ranks a match.

Reconfirmation, response reliability, richer communication, repeat shipments, fleet imports, proof of pickup/delivery and better lane-price calibration come before new modes.
Parcels, shared travel and business logistics can reuse careful matching foundations—but each requires a distinct trust, custody, safety, insurance and regulatory plan.
Support full-truck and shared-capacity freight with transparent matching reasons, quotes, booking state, public driver/operator browsing and strong freshness controls.
Improve notifications, dispatch and fleet tools, business shipment accounts, reconfirmation, proof of delivery and data-backed price calibration. The test is useful connections and reliable outcomes, not feature count.
Explore small parcels through professional transport capacity first. Door-to-door or hub handoff, custody, identity, tracking, proof and liability controls have to exist before broader delivery is offered.
People already travelling between towns may someday publish spare seats. This will not launch merely because a data model can support it: passenger safety, identity, insurance, compliance and incident processes need a dedicated foundation.
Potential areas include recurring routes, contracts, fleet analytics, invoicing, warehouses or hubs, integrations, broader vehicle classes and properly governed payments or insurance partnerships.
Measure fresh capacity, useful matches, quote response, bookings, cancellations, repeat usage and balanced demand/supply across major lanes.
Define identity, reporting, custody, insurance and operational responsibility before exposing people or goods to a new type of risk.
Payments, tracking, warehousing or any regulated service appear only after the right partners, process and compliance capability genuinely exist.
